The definition of "int" I carry around in my head is "use whatever length
is natural and convenient on this machine; makes no difference to me."
There may be compilers that do not adhere to this (my 68000 compiler
requires a command-line switch), but I think that qualifies as a compiler
bug and a #define is in order.
As far as I've ever observed, word instructions execute at just about the
same speed as longword instructions on the vax -- ie, no penalty -- unless
you start mixing them.
